F. Adjust the Parking Brake System
S 825-017
(1)
Adjust the parking brake system:
(a)
Align the rig pin holes in the rudder pedal arms with the rig pin holes in the adjacent structure.
NOTE: Use the crank for the rudder pedal adjustment to
____ move the rudder pedal arms and align the rig pin holes, if it is necessary.
(b)
Install a rig pin through the right and left rudder pedal arms and adjacent structure.
(c)
Push on the brake pedals until the pushrod lever on the brake pedal bus is against the stop (Fig. 501, Detail F).
(d)
Hold the brakes in this position.
(e)
If the pawls move when you pull the parking brake lever, adjust the parking brake pawls.
(f)
Adjust the pawls as follows until you get a clearance of 0.02-0.06 inch between the pawls and the lock pin (Fig. 501, Detail A): 1) Loosen the lock nut on the pawls. 2) If it is necessary, turn the pawls to get the specified
clearance.
3) Tighten the locknut.
(g)
Pull the lever to set the parking brake.
(h)
Release the parking brake.
NOTE: The parking brake must release when the brake pedals are
____ pushed to the stops and then released. The pawls must be clear of the lock pins on the brake bellcrank (Fig. 501, Detail C).
(i) Adjust the bumper stop against the pawl as follows:
1) Install or remove the washers to get a pawl lever angle of 2-5 degrees from the vertical (Fig. 501, View E).
S 015-029
(2)
If the adjustement of the parking brake lever is necessary, remove the access panel from the left side of the control stand. This will give access to the rod assembly for the parking brake lever (AMM 76-11-03/201).
S 825-018
(3)
If it is necessary, adjust the parking brake lever (Fig. 501, Sheet 4):
(a)
Disconnect the lower end of the rod assembly to the inboard lever (Fig. 501, Detail G).

(b) Turn the lower end of the rod in half turn increments to adjust the rod assembly length.
NOTE: Do not remove the cotter pin in the clevis end of the
____
rod.
1) Make sure you have a clearance of 0.005-0.040 inches between the top surface of the control stand and the lever (Fig. 501, View A-A).
(c)
Tighten the nut at the lower end of the rod.
(d)
Install the bolt, washer and nut.
(e)
Tighten the nut.
(f)
Operate the parking brake lever and linkage to make sure it moves smoothly.
S 415-005
(4)
Install the access panel on the left side of the control stand if you removed it (AMM 76-11-03/201).
